About Elizabeth Keogh
|
|
Liz Keogh currently works as an independent Agile Coach and trainer based in London. She is a well-known blogger and international speaker, a core member of the BDD community and a contributor to a number of open-source projects including JBehave.
Liz has written over a dozen workshops on subjects as diverse as story-writing, haiku poetry, systems thinking, effective personal feedback and OO development, and has extensive experience in delivering courses internationally, having worked in a number of different countries including China and India.
Liz has a strong technical background with over 10 years’ experience in delivering and coaching others to deliver large-scale enterprise applications, which she now combines with a focus on psychology, NLP and adult learning. She has pioneered the application of learning models in measuring Agile maturity and coaching progress, and most of her work now focuses on Agile and architectural organizational transformations, and the use of positive language, targets and metrics in facilitating change.
Liz Keogh is a recepient of the Gordon Pask Award at Agile 2010.
She is also a science fiction writer and haiku poet.
